Starting about 6 years ago, once a year...I started getting this sensataion. It typically arrives around 9pm and keeps me wide awake all night. Burning in the shoulder and running down thru bicep and even radiating down as far as my wrist, concentrated in the shoulder though. It seems to be gaining momentum. I got it twice last year and twice already in 2009. Today for the first time ever, it kept me awake all night, disappeared for a little while and now its back in the middle of the day when I tried to take a power nap.

My two thoughts have always been : oh shit, heart attack symptom. or if not.. then some sort of F'd up acid reflux that is centered in my shoulder of all places.. but is it possible to have had 10 mini heart attacks over the past 6 years?... or is it possible to have acid reflux without any stomach ailment? I don't know? Figured I'd ask my peers here in this group since alot of you have experienced my age already. I am 41 now. 6' 7", 280 lbs. gotta drop some lbs for sure.

I will hit up the urgent care tomorrow AM if this shit hasn't left. I did some online research and there was suggestion of this being a symtom of possibly gall bladder prob or even liver prob. Yikes. anyone ever get this shit before?

Do you have pain when you move your shoulder? Burning may be nerve pain. I had something like that 6 yrs ago. Went to the orthopedist and he gave me a couple steroid shots and got better. An MRI shoulder impingment syndrome,where the nerve gets inflammed and hurts very much. Could barley wipe my butt when I went to the bathroom. Good luck
